
Lavra of Saint Athanasius
The Lavra of Saint Athanasius is a historic Eastern Orthodox monastic complex located on Mount Athos in Greece. It serves as a spiritual center where monks live, work, and worship together, following centuries-old traditions. Named after Saint Athanasius, an important church father, the lavra features monasteries, churches, and chapels, overseeing religious services, education, and preservation of religious manuscripts. It’s renowned for its rich history, spiritual significance, and role as a center of Orthodox Christian monastic life, attracting pilgrims and visitors seeking spiritual reflection and religious community.
